Intoxicase: The beer drinker’s iPhone case and app

“An iPhone case with a built-in bottle opener? That’s nothing new. It’s a whole category,” Harry McCracken reports for TIME Magazine. “But the creators of the $35 Intoxicase say that it’s the first one that comes with an app that uses the phone’s gyroscope to detect when you’ve opened a bottle, so it can tally up how many beers you’ve consumed.”

“The app has many features, most of which work even if you don’t have the case. A representative of Spicebox, the company behind intoxicase – spicebox LLCIntoxicase (free), told me that it ‘[balances] social with responsibility,’ which seems to be a way of saying that it’s for people who like to drink a lot of beer — it includes a intoxicase – spicebox LLCBottle-O-Meter that goes all the way to ‘Wasted’ and logs how much brew you’ve drunk in gallons — but also has a feature that lets you call a cab,” McCracken reports. “(Then again, it also has a feature that lets you find where you parked your car.)”
